LINEAR PROGRAMMING AND GAME THEORY-------PHI
Description:
This compact book
is an excellent elucidation of the basics of optimization theory in the
areas of linear programming and game theory. The theory has been
developed in a systematic manner with a recapitulation of the necessary
mathematical preliminaries including in good measure the elements of
convexity theory. All the essential topics such as simplex algorithm,
duality, revised simplex method, two-phase method and dual simplex
method have been discussed lucidly. The age-old transportation and
assignment problems have been treated thoroughly to manifest all the
dimensions of the problems. Finally, the game theory comes with grandeur
of reality of conflicts.
This user-friendly text is designed
for the undergraduate students in mathematics. Besides, it will be
useful to students pursuing courses in engineering, management and
economics.
